Priyanka Taslim

    Priyanka Taslim crea historias centradas en familias, comunidades y el drama inherente a ellas. Inspirada por su crianza dentro de una vibrante diáspora de Bangladesh, sus narrativas a menudo destacan a jóvenes heroínas bangladesíes llenas de energía que navegan por su lugar en el mundo. Estos personajes cautivadores a menudo se ven acompañados por un toque de dulce romance. Taslim, quien también enseña inglés en secundaria, infunde en su escritura una voz auténtica y una narración cautivadora.

    The Love Match
    • To All the Boys I've Loved Before meets Pride and Prejudice in this swoony and thoughtful romantic comedy from debut author Priyanka Taslim. Zahra Khan is basically Bangladeshi royalty - but being a princess doesn't pay the bills in New Jersey. While Zahra plans to save money for college by working through the summer at a tea shop, her meddling mum is convinced that a "good match" in marriage will solve their family's financial woes. Enter Harun Emon, the wealthy, devastatingly handsome and . . . aloof boy Zahra is set up with. As soon as they meet, Zahra and Harun both know it's not going to work. It's nothing like the connection she has with Nayim Aktar, the new dishwasher at the tea shop, who just gets her in a way no one has before. Deciding to slowly sabotage their parents' plans, Zahra and Harun pretend to date, while Zahra explores her feelings for Nayim. For once in Zahra's life, she can have her rossomalai and eat it too. But life - and boys - can be a royal pain. With her feelings all mixed up, will Zahra be a good Bengali kid or can she find her one true love match?
